Purpose
Explain one thing as a picture, for a reader assumed to know nothing about it.
The output contract is fixed: a visual HTML explainer that assumes zero prior
knowledge: one idea per diagram, minimal text. That contract is what makes this a
distinct lane rather than a second prose explainer. education:explain drops
altitude and stays in prose; this skill changes the medium, and its floor does
not move on request.
The lane exists because the capability ships upstream as a community plugin. This skill delegates to that plugin when the user has it, helps them install it when they do not, and performs the behavior itself either way, so the user is never left with nothing.
Step 1. Ground the object before drawing it
A diagram of a thing you recalled wrongly is a confident, beautiful, wrong answer. Re-read the actual artifact this turn. What that means depends on the object:
| Object | Grounding pre-pass |
|---|---|
| A module, file, or subsystem | Read the code. Follow its imports and its callers far enough to know what it actually does, not what its name suggests. |
| A tradeoff or design decision | Read the ADRs, the git history, and the pull-request discussion where it was argued. The reasoning lives in the debate, not the result. |
| An incident | Read the writeup and the logs. Reconstruct the sequence before drawing the causal chain. |
| A general concept | Fetch a primary source. Do not draw from parametric memory. |
If the grounding pass cannot be done (no access, no such artifact), say so and ask, rather than drawing a plausible diagram of something you did not read.

Step 3. The inline pass
Build the explainer directly, to the same contract.
- One idea per diagram. If a diagram needs a paragraph to be read, it is two diagrams.
- Diagram first, prose second. Each diagram carries a one-line takeaway caption saying what the reader should conclude from it. The caption is the point; the surrounding text is scaffolding.
- Demote the identifiers. Real function, file, and service names belong in parentheses or monospace, after the plain-words version of what the thing does. A zero-knowledge reader cannot use a name they have never seen as the subject of a sentence.
- Inline SVG for the diagrams, so the page stands alone with nothing to fetch.
- When the
artifact-designandartifact-diagrammingsession skills are available, load them before writing the page; they own the visual bar. Without them, hold to the same rules directly.
Delivering the page
Producing the HTML is half the job; the reader has to be able to look at it. Take the first rung that this session supports, and say which one you took:
| Condition | Delivery |
|---|---|
| An Artifact surface is available | Publish the page as an artifact |
| No artifact surface, a writable temp location | Write one file to the OS temp directory and hand back its path |
| Neither | Describe the diagrams in structured terminal text, and say the page was not rendered |
Never write the page into the consuming repository, and never paste raw HTML or SVG markup into the terminal as though it were the explainer. A picture the reader cannot open is not a delivered picture: when you land on the third rung, say so plainly rather than implying a page exists.
